Why choose zirconia for prosthetic restorations?

Zirconia is a zirconium oxide that has been processed into a high-performance ceramic. It possesses mechanical and aesthetic properties that make it an ideal material for both single-tooth and multi-tooth restorations.

The main advantages of zirconia:

  • High fracture resistance: suitable for posterior regions and long-span bridges
  • Natural appearance: translucency similar to that of dentin, especially with the latest generation of zirconia
  • Biocompatibility: no rejection, excellent tolerance by soft tissues
  • Metal-free: ideal for patients with allergies or those seeking an all-ceramic restoration
  • Long-term stability: resistance to wear and corrosion

Zirconia thus combines durability with aesthetic appeal, even for restorations subjected to high stress.

Common indications for zirconia dentures

Thanks to its versatility, zirconia is suitable for a wide range of clinical situations. At LABOCAD, we recommend its use in the following cases:

  • Single-unit anterior or posterior crowns
  • Bridges on natural teeth or on implants
  • Ceramic frameworks for laminate restorations
  • Aesthetic screw-retained restorations
  • Custom prosthetic limbs

The variety of zirconia types (high, medium, or low translucency) allows the material to be tailored to the specific needs of each clinical case.

High-precision digital manufacturing at LABOCAD

LABOCAD integrates zirconia into acomplete digital workflow, from receiving the STL file through machining and finishing.

Our zirconia manufacturing process:

  1. Receipt and verification of digital files
  2. Computer-Aided Design (CAD)
  3. Precision machining of multilayer zirconia discs
  4. Controlled sintering to ensure dimensional stability
  5. Colors, finish, and lamination (if applicable)

This process allows us to ensureexcellent marginal adaptation, a controlled aesthetic result, and high reproducibility.
